Vote BJP -backed candidates to give more speed to the development of rural areas: Chief Minister’s appeal
* Chief Minister Vishnu Dev Sai made votes to voters for three-tier panchayat elections Vishnu Dev Sai has appealed to voters to vote for the Bharatiya Janata Party -backed candidates for the three -tier panchayat elections – 2025. He said that under the first phase of the three-level panchayat elections, votes will be cast in 53 development blocks of the state tomorrow. It is worth noting that under the three-level panchayat elections, voting is to be held in 53 development blocks of the state tomorrow. The results of which will be declared on 18 February.
